Steel constructions F174 (DIN 18550), tempered steel at
90/100 kgs. mm2
, stabilized to 570ºC/600ºC and subse-
quent surface treatment by means of gas nitrating, with
HV-1000/1500 hardness and a layer thickness of 500/700
microns, surface finishes by grinding and rubbing the sur-
face, with tolerances from 0,01 to 0,02 mm and construc-
tions in bimetallic alloys for both cylinders and screws.
We manufacture and repair plastic barrels and screws with
the most advanced abrasion/corrosion resistant alloys and
reinforcements in the market, designed with wear-resis-
tance properties against materials with heavy workloads,
such as fiberglass, calcium carbonate, talc, fluorinated
products, etc

4. Husillos de extrusión
We manufacture and repair all kinds of screws for the pro-
per transformation of plastics, thermoplastics, rubber, sili-
cones, etc..
We seal our spindles with the most advanced technolo-
gy of special welding available, such as powder welding.
Against abrasion, corrosion and agents that accelerate
wear and tear, we use resistant materials such as Tungs-
ten-Carbon, colmonoy, stellite, etc.

7. We repair every type of screw and barrel, leaving the material with the same characteristics and dimensions as
the original.
DOBLE CÁMARA CÓNICA Y PARALELA
BARRELS
We repair the interior parts of barrels with adaptable tolerance to
the specific screw you will use in the future. Additionally, we also
carry out the subsequent hardness treatment.
In case the barrel is very deteriorated, we proceed to the interior
jacketing by respecting the original measures and using bimeta-
llic or nitride-based materials according to the materials charac-
teristics. This is how we get a better lifespan guarantee than the
original one.
SCREWS
Screws are reconditioned with the most advanced alloys by means
of a welding procedure, which increases their nominal width in or-
der to fit to the barrel.
